Job Description

Delivers clinical laboratory services for IOM migration health assessments in Nepal, performing diagnostic procedures, safeguarding biosafety and quality, maintaining equipment and stocks, managing records and data, and supporting continuous improvement of laboratory systems and patient services.

Summary of Responsibilities

  • Perform pre-examination, examination and post-examination laboratory procedures
  • Implement quality-management systems and serve as focal point for assigned quality essentials
  • Apply standard operating procedures, biosafety measures and quality-control processes
  • Operate and maintain laboratory equipment and document quality-assurance results
  • Manage laboratory stocks and alert supervisors to equipment, supply or biosafety issues
  • Maintain records and data systems for results, monitoring, analysis and operational research
  • Develop and update laboratory standard operating procedures with the supervisor
  • Improve service delivery while protecting patient dignity and meeting client expectations

Role Requirements

  • Bachelor's degree or accredited diploma in medical laboratory sciences, microbiology or a related discipline
  • Valid professional practice licence
  • Three years of relevant clinical laboratory experience with a bachelor's degree, or five years with a diploma
  • Clinical laboratory techniques, quality-management and biosafety knowledge
  • Computer literacy for accurate data collection, analysis and laboratory-performance monitoring
  • Fluency in written and spoken English and Nepali
